把DS18B20的驅(qū)動(dòng)移植到STM32上來(lái)。
Everyboard Can Sing
Everyboard Can Sing
ICSP(In-Circuit Serial Programming)即在線串行編程,通過(guò)保持RB6和RB7引腳為低電平,VDD 為編程電壓,并將MCLR(VPP)引腳電壓從VIL增加到VIHH,器件便進(jìn)入編程/校驗(yàn)?zāi)J?。此時(shí),RB6為編程時(shí)鐘線,RB7為編程數(shù)據(jù)線。在該模式下,RB6和RB7都是施密特觸發(fā)器輸入,當(dāng)RB7驅(qū)動(dòng)數(shù)據(jù)時(shí),它是CMOS輸出驅(qū)動(dòng)。
單片機(jī)系統(tǒng)經(jīng)常需要存取一些少量的參數(shù),如串口的地址碼,波特率,等等,裝這些參數(shù)通過(guò)PC機(jī)進(jìn)行設(shè)置,并存儲(chǔ)在本地,同時(shí)可以利用通訊端口來(lái)修改。
在此介紹STM32單片機(jī)串口一鍵下載電路與操作方法詳解。
C8051F120單片機(jī)主要特性
學(xué)習(xí)使用單片機(jī)就是理解單片機(jī)硬件結(jié)構(gòu),以及內(nèi)部資源的應(yīng)用,在匯編或C語(yǔ)言中學(xué)會(huì)各種功能的初始化設(shè)置,以及實(shí)現(xiàn)各種功能的程序編制。
本文介紹用74HC165讀8個(gè)按鍵狀態(tài)
單片機(jī)主要作用是控制外圍的器件,并實(shí)現(xiàn)一定的通信和數(shù)據(jù)處理。但在某些特定場(chǎng)合,不可避免地要用到數(shù)學(xué)運(yùn)算,盡管單片機(jī)并不擅長(zhǎng)實(shí)現(xiàn)算法和進(jìn)行復(fù)雜的運(yùn)算。下面主要是介紹如何用單片機(jī)實(shí)現(xiàn)數(shù)字濾波。
單片機(jī)中的定時(shí)器和計(jì)數(shù)器其實(shí)是同一個(gè)物理的電子元件,只不過(guò)計(jì)數(shù)器記錄的是單片機(jī)外部發(fā)生的事情(接受的是外部脈沖),而定時(shí)器則是由單片機(jī)自身提供的一個(gè)非常穩(wěn)定的計(jì)數(shù)器,這個(gè)穩(wěn)定的計(jì)數(shù)器就是單片機(jī)上連接的晶振部件;
說(shuō)到單片機(jī),大家第一時(shí)間想到的應(yīng)該是51單片機(jī),對(duì)吧。不錯(cuò),更高級(jí)一點(diǎn)的AVR,把他稱為單片機(jī),我們也還覺(jué)得可以接受。那么再高級(jí)一點(diǎn)的ARM7,8086,80386,Core i3,Athlon 等等我們更習(xí)慣稱他們?yōu)镃PU,因?yàn)閷W(xué)習(xí)計(jì)算機(jī)原理的時(shí)候都是這么叫的,但按照單片機(jī)的定義,他們也是歸屬于單片機(jī)。
通信協(xié)議: 第1字節(jié),MSB為1,為第1字節(jié)標(biāo)志,第2字節(jié),MSB為0,為非第一字節(jié)標(biāo)志,其余類推……,最后一個(gè)字節(jié)為前幾個(gè)字節(jié)后7位的異或校驗(yàn)和。
單片機(jī)現(xiàn)在可謂是鋪天蓋地,種類繁多,讓開(kāi)發(fā)者們應(yīng)接不暇,發(fā)展也是相當(dāng)?shù)难杆?,從上世紀(jì)80年代,由當(dāng)時(shí)的4位8位發(fā)展到現(xiàn)在的各種高速單片機(jī)……
對(duì)于EMI的控制滲透在電路設(shè)計(jì)的每一個(gè)角落當(dāng)中,在IC芯片的封裝當(dāng)中也有針對(duì)EMI進(jìn)行預(yù)防的方法,本文就將為大家介紹封裝特征在EMI控制當(dāng)中的作用。
隨著單片機(jī)系統(tǒng)越來(lái)越廣泛地應(yīng)用于消費(fèi)類電子、醫(yī)療、工業(yè)自動(dòng)化、智能化儀器儀表、航空航天等各領(lǐng)域,單片機(jī)系統(tǒng)面臨著電磁干擾(EMI)日益嚴(yán)重的威脅。電磁兼容性(EMC)包含系統(tǒng)的發(fā)射和敏感度兩方面的問(wèn)題。如果一個(gè)單片機(jī)系統(tǒng)符合下面三個(gè)條件,則該系統(tǒng)是電磁兼容的
1.引言如果環(huán)境溫度超過(guò)或低于限定值,必定對(duì)所處環(huán)境的人和設(shè)備造成影響,甚至給個(gè)人和社會(huì)造成巨大的損失。隨著單片機(jī)技術(shù)的飛速發(fā)展,利用單片機(jī)設(shè)計(jì)溫控系統(tǒng)成為控制技
下面是總結(jié)的一些設(shè)計(jì)中應(yīng)注意的問(wèn)題,和單片機(jī)硬件設(shè)計(jì)原則,希望大家能看完(1) 在元器件的布局方面,應(yīng)該把相互有關(guān)的元件盡量放得靠近一些,例如,時(shí)鐘發(fā)生器、晶振、CP
對(duì)于每個(gè)單片機(jī)愛(ài)好者及工程開(kāi)發(fā)設(shè)計(jì)人員,在剛接觸單片機(jī)的那最初的青蔥歲月里,都有過(guò)點(diǎn)亮跑馬燈的經(jīng)歷。從看到那一排排小燈按著我們的想法在跳動(dòng)時(shí)激動(dòng)心情。到隨著經(jīng)驗(yàn)越多,越來(lái)又會(huì)感覺(jué)到這個(gè)小燈是個(gè)好東西,尤其是在調(diào)試資源有限的環(huán)境中,有時(shí)會(huì)幫上大忙。
分析指令階段的任務(wù)是:將指令寄存器中的指令操作碼取出后進(jìn)行譯碼,分析其指令性質(zhì)。如指令要求操作數(shù),則尋找操作數(shù)地址。計(jì)算機(jī)執(zhí)行程序的過(guò)程實(shí)際上就是逐條指令地重復(fù)上述操作過(guò)程,直至遇到停機(jī)指令可循環(huán)等待指令。一般計(jì)算機(jī)進(jìn)行工作時(shí),首先要通過(guò)外部設(shè)備把程序和數(shù)據(jù)通過(guò)輸入接口電路和數(shù)據(jù)總線送入到存儲(chǔ)器,然后逐條取出執(zhí)行。但單片機(jī)中的程序一般事先我們都已通過(guò)寫入器固化在片內(nèi)或片外程序存儲(chǔ)器中。因而一開(kāi)機(jī)即可執(zhí)行指令。